Grief is not limited to the loss of a person. It can come with the end of a relationship, a divorce, a change in identity, a career transition, or letting go of the life you thought you would have. Loss has a way of changing us, and healing is not about forgetting or moving on. It is about making space for your grief while reconnecting with yourself and the life that still lies ahead.
